I am standing on a cliff not knowing how i got there. I look up and see a man staring in the distance and somehow i know that he's going to jump off the cliff into the ocean below. i look down and i can see rocks jutting out of the crashing waves. he looks at me but i can't see his face and he keeps saying that he's a professional and i try to tell him not to jump but he jumps off the cliff. then all of a sudden i'm on a boat and we are looking for the man. when we find him he's dead and decayed for as long as what looks like months but i know it's been less than a week. the wierdest part is that after i woke up i wrote it down like i do every dream but i was talking to my friend a few days later and she showed me what she wrote down.. almost exactly what i wrote. what does this mean??

I love people who keep dream journals! First, your dream shifted. There is always a pattern to shifts, bringing the dreamer from the general to the specific, from an explanation to an application, from a broad time period to a specific time period, from the future or past to the present. A shift’s purpose is to bring the attention of the dreamer from the cause, the general, the outline or action, to the result, the specific, the consequence or ramification. There is always a from shift to. In your case it could have been from the past to the present. Without asking questions (read my profile) it’s impossible for me to get it right, but what I say may give you a nudge in the right direction.

You’re on the edge (verge) concerning a decision you are about make, possibly regarding your profession (job?). You were told not to jump but you did. You take the leap (plunge), it’s risky.

Shift

It has been less than a week but seems like ages ago. Your search has come to an end and it is now a dead issue.

You and your friend have a telepathic connection – not that uncommon.
